Sec. 115.418  What types of trust funds may a minor have?

    A minor may have one or more of the following types of trust funds:
    (a) Judgment per capita funds: Withdrawals may only be made upon BIA

[[Page 330]]

approval of an application made under Public Law 97-458. See 25 CFR 1.2.
    (b) Tribal per capita funds: Withdrawals may only be made under a 
BIA approved distribution plan and in accordance with the terms of the 
tribe's per capita resolution/document.
    (c) Other trust funds: Withdrawals may only be made under a minor's 
BIA-approved distribution plan that is based on a justified unmet need 
for the minor's health, education, or welfare.
    (d) Funds from other federal agencies (e.g., SSA, SSI, VA) received 
for the benefit of the minor: Withdrawals must be made only under a BIA-
approved distribution plan that must be consistent with the disbursing 
agency's (e.g., SSA, SSI, VA) allowable uses for the funds.
